我希望在表格单元格内实现一个可扩展的 TextView ,我找到了 GrowingTextView 但我仍然未能实现。我需要从用户那里获取输入,并且当用户输入时单元格会自动调整大小。有没有更简单的实现或指南?谢谢大家
最佳答案
实际上您不需要第 3 方库来执行此操作。
- 将 GrowingTextView 更改为
UILabel
将您的 UILabel 配置为单元格的
Top、Left、Right 和 Bottom
,并使“Title”标签依赖于 UILabel 这很重要,因为单元格大小取决于 UILabel 的内容。将
numberOfLines
设置为 0 和- 将
lineBreakMode
设置为word wrapping
或character warpping
- 设置
tableView.rowHeight = UITableViewAutomaticDimension
和tableView.estimatedRowHeight = 150//或者您认为合理的任何值
对于这样的任务,我建议您可以在 Internet 上做更多的研究,而不是这么快地使用第 3 方库,这里的关键字是动态表格 View 单元格,通过在 Google 上搜索,有很多教程可以帮助您解决问题,而无需使用第 3 方库派对图书馆。
关于ios - GrowingTextView 或 UItableview 单元格内的可扩展 TextView 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50919568/